Runners from 106 countries and all around Turkey participated in the 41 edition of the Istanbul Marathon, held under the banner "Istanbul is Yours, Don't Stop, Run". It is regarded as one of the best marathons in Europe, with a route connecting the Asian and European continents, crossing a bridge over the Bosphorus strait. Participants competed in three categories: the full 42 km marathon, a 15 km race and a public run, which was held on an 8 km route.
The marathon primarily aims to attract runners who compete for charities. Last year, charities collected a total of TRY 12.1 million (EUR 1.8 million) in donations and this year this amount reached TRY 17.3 million with 13,286 runners collecting donations from 153,938 donators, which will serve to help 21,697 living beings, (trees, animals, humans, etc.)
The “Adım Adım” (“Step by Step”) initiative is a volunteer-based social initiative in Turkey. Established in 2007 by six social entrepreneurs, it was founded in order to motivate Turkish citizens who did not have the inclination to raise money for a charitable organisation of their own choice, to help address urgent social problems. At that time, nearly 90% of charitable support for non-governmental organisations (NGOs) came from corporate or institutional donations, and NGOs struggled to engage grassroots support for their initiatives.
For the first 8 years, Adım Adım operated within a core group of 8 NGOs. In 2016, they decided to expand. At this point, Türkiye Alzheimer Derneği (the Turkish Alzheimer association) joined Adım Adım, in order to benefit from charitable donations given through the sponsorship of athletes in local sports events. All stakeholders - fundraisers (runners), donors, and NGOs - were connected via a comprehensive online platform.
There are stringent conditions to become a member of this platform: a transparency manifesto must be signed; the NGO’s balance sheets for the last three years must be published on the web; and finally it is necessary to present a project for the marathon, with all financial details.
This year, the Turkish Alzheimer association proudly announced its participation in its 5 consecutive marathon. 127 runners collected approximately EUR 56,000 from 2,192 donators. Over the five marathons, 787 runners have collected a total of EUR 154,000. The first two marathons raised funds for home care services and the last three have raised funds for the daycare centre in Istanbul.
